Chelsea through despite scoreless draw
Marcel Desailly announced in his programme notes before this Champions League clash that Chelsea were at last playing “with rhythm”.
That rhythm had seen Claudio Ranieri’s men build a run of seven straight victories, including four successive clean sheets – the highlight of which was the 4-0 thrashing of Lazio in Rome earlier this month to surge to the top of Group G.
